SC legislators adjourn, gov tells them to return

(AP) -- COLUMBIA, S.C. (AP) - South Carolina Gov. Nikki Haley is telling South Carolina lawmakers to return to their desks to deal with unfinished work.

Legislators officially reached their official adjournment deadline at 5 p.m. Thursday. But Haley immediately told legislators she wanted them back at work on Tuesday.

They'd already planned to return on June 14 for wrap-up session.

Haley wants lawmakers to approve a measure moving control of much of the state's bureaucracy into a Cabinet agency that would report to her. Senators had debated the bill for more than an hour Thursday but it did not reach a final vote before the formal deadline.
